>Christopher Markus and Stephen McFeely's original approach was Captain America and Falcon searching for Bucky while Zemo is orchestrating global turmoil. The "Civil War" element was added later on, partially in response to BATMAN V SUPERMAN: DAWN OF JUSTICE.

>In early drafts, T'Challa was just a diplomat advocating for superhero accountability on behalf of Wakanda, and Spider-Man was the outsider who provided a different viewpoint than Captain America's and his followers and Iron Man's and his followers. When negotiations with Sony nearly fell through, Black Panther got propped up, and then Spider-Man became available anyway.

>The Wasp was in earlier drafts, and there was also an extended sequence about Scott Lang's life in San Francisco that got scrapped and never filmed.

>The Russos cut a scene between Black Widow and Black Panther at the German base after the battle in Romania because they felt it was redundant. Overall, roughly 12 minutes have been deleted from their assembly cut.

>"You just started a war" and "I was wrong about you, the whole world was wrong about you" got cut, probably part of an extended confrontation at the Siberian Hydra base.

Also, Markus and McFeely apparently presented their first story draft before seeing ANT-MAN and put Ant-Man on Stark's side before it was pointed out to them the grudge between Hank Pym and the Stark family.
